Neighborhood Overview

Pleasantville Middle School is located in a quiet, residential area of Pleasantville, Iowa, providing a straightforward setting for athletic events and school activities. Access to the venue is primarily gained via local arterial roads that connect directly to the main thoroughfares serving the region. Parking is available on-site, primarily utilizing the school's dedicated lots, which are designed to accommodate standard traffic flows during school hours and evening events. The nearest major airport is Des Moines International (DSM), located approximately 35 miles to the northwest, which typically requires a 45-minute drive depending on traffic conditions.

Navigating the area is generally efficient as the town layout is compact and easy to traverse by car. While public transit is extremely limited in this rural setting, rideshare availability exists but should not be relied upon as a primary mode of transportation for large groups. We recommend planning for your arrival at least 30 minutes before your scheduled start time to allow for parking and walking to the specific field or gym entrance. During peak event times, local roads may experience minor congestion, so utilizing the main entrance routes as marked by signage is the most effective approach for all visitors.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Iowa are cold with frequent snow, so pack heavy coats, hats, and gloves. Most events are held indoors during this time, making the weather less of a factor for active participation. Be prepared for potential road delays due to snow and icy conditions when traveling to the venue.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This is the primary season for outdoor athletics and community festivals. The weather is generally pleasant, though you should be prepared for occasional spring showers. Dress in layers to stay comfortable throughout the day as temperatures shift from morning to afternoon.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summer brings hot and humid conditions to the region, making hydration essential for all athletes and spectators. Seek shade whenever possible and wear lightweight, breathable clothing to stay cool. It is the perfect time for outdoor activities, provided you manage your exposure to the midday sun.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ers crisp, cool weather that is ideal for outdoor sports and campus activities. Pack a light jacket or sweater for the cooler mornings and evenings. The changing foliage makes it a beautiful time to visit the area for any scheduled team events.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ur throughout the year, so always carry rain gear or waterproof clothing. Heavy snow is common in winter, which can impact travel times significantly. Always check local weather reports before you depart to ensure your route is clear and safe for driving.
